A company that connects advertisers with publishers, facilitating the purchase of ad inventory across multiple websites through a single platform.
Advertising Network
by Alex Brinkman | August 2, 2024 | 0 comments
A company that connects advertisers with publishers, facilitating the purchase of ad inventory across multiple websites through a single platform.